cholesteric

English

Etymology

From cholesterol, in whose crystals it was first observed, +? -ic.

Adjective

cholesteric (comparative more cholesteric, superlative most cholesteric)

  1. (physics) Of or relating to the chiral nematic phase of some liquid crystals in which the molecules are arranged in parallel planes with adjacent planes rotated slightly
  2. (organic chemistry) Relating to cholesteric acid or its derivatives
